
Ocean Special Area Management Plan
An Ocean Special Area Management Plan (SAMP) is a strategic framework designed to manage the use and protection of ocean resources in a specific area. It involves assessing environmental, economic, and social factors to balance various activities, like fishing, tourism, and conservation. Stakeholders, such as local communities and government agencies, collaborate to create guidelines that promote sustainable practices while addressing potential conflicts among different ocean uses. The goal is to ensure the health of marine ecosystems and support the livelihoods of those who depend on them, fostering a harmonious relationship between people and the ocean.
